Lexar JumpDrive M20 Series USB Flash Drives (2013) vs Kingston DataTraveler Max (1 TB)

Analysis:

The Lexar JumpDrive M20 16GB was loved by reviewers at Laptop Mag, a highly trusted source that performs reliable in-depth testing. It did great in its "Best cheap USB flash drives (under $10), 7 ranked best to worst" roundup where it was named its "Ranked 1 out of 7", which, in itself, makes it a product worth considering.

Taking a look at the Kingston DataTraveler Max (1 TB), we found that it hasn't managed to perform well enough to earn a spot in any USB Flash Drive roundups done by sources that conduct their own, high-quality, hands-on testing. That alone makes it difficult to recommend.

Lastly, we tried to do a direct Lexar JumpDrive M20 16GB vs. Kingston DataTraveler Max (1 TB) comparison of review ratings between these two products, but couldn't find any review scores for the Kingston DataTraveler Max (1 TB).

Compared to all other USB Flash Drives on the market, however, the Lexar JumpDrive M20 16GB performed great. When averaged out, it earned a rating of 8.0 out of 10, which is much better than the 7.2 review average of USB Flash Drives in general.
